Setting Up Patient Tables and Codes > Setting Up Financial Codes
Use billing categories to separate receivables into classifications and assign appropriate billing defaults.
You can separate receivables for collection patients or for patients belonging to a certain PPO. Use categories if you have a group of patients for whom you need to use an alternate fee schedule, not impose service charges, or not send statements.
Example: A patient who has standard commercial insurance coverage but who is ultimately responsible for paying the bill.
Use Practice Preferences to specify the default billing category assigned to new patients.
To add a billing category code:
Select Tables > Patients > Billing Categories. The Billing Category Search window is displayed.
Click New. The Billing Category Data Entry window is displayed.
Type a description for the new billing category code.
The code is automatically assigned by WinOMS.
In the Indicators section, select the indicators you want to apply to this category.
Select Use Default Dunning Messages to use the messages set up in the Practice Data Entry window, or type the dunning message specific to this billing category in one of the Dunning Message fields.
To override the checkout options on the System Defaults tab of the Practice Data Entry window, select Override Practice Charge Window Exit Options. This option removes the predefined options on the Charge window and enables you to select new options to use for the specified billing category.
In the Default Action field, use the drop-down list to select Print, Payment Wizard, or No Processing.
Select the Charge window exit options to use for the specified billing category:
Print Walkout Statement
Include Insurance Information
Include All Transactions
Process Walkout Automatically
Print Insurance Form
Process Insurance Automatically
Merge Letter
Click Ok. The Billing Indicators Update window is displayed.
Click Ok. A message is displayed, indicating that no patients are currently associated with this billing category.
Use the Billing Category Search window (Tables > Patients > Billing Categories) to select a category to edit or delete. Use the search feature, or click Display All to locate the category.
When you edit or delete a category, you are prompted to confirm the action.
